Tools of the Trade

The tools available to 3D conceptual photographers are as varied as they are powerful. Software such as Blender, Autodesk Maya, and Cinema 4D provide robust platforms for creating 3D models and environments. Additionally, advancements in rendering technology, such as ray tracing and global illumination, have enhanced the realism and depth of 3D images, making them almost indistinguishable from real-world photographs.

The Creative Process

The creative process in 3D conceptual photography begins with an idea. Artists often draw inspiration from a wide range of sources, including literature, mythology, dreams, and personal experiences. Once an idea has taken shape, the artist begins the meticulous process of designing and modeling the 3D elements that will bring their vision to life.

After the models are created, the artist carefully crafts the composition, lighting, and textures to evoke the desired mood and atmosphere. This stage is akin to traditional photography, where the photographer must consider how light and shadow interact with the subject. However, in 3D conceptual photography, artists have complete control over every aspect of the scene, allowing for unparalleled creative expression.

Applications and Impact

The impact of 3D conceptual photography extends beyond the realm of art. Its applications are being explored across various industries, including advertising, film, gaming, and virtual reality. Brands are leveraging the power of 3D visuals to create captivating marketing campaigns that resonate with audiences on a deeper level. In the film industry, 3D conceptual photography is being used to design stunning visual effects and immersive environments that enhance storytelling.

Furthermore, the rise of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ies has opened new avenues for 3D conceptual photography. Artists can now create fully immersive experiences, allowing viewers to step into their creations and interact with them in unprecedented ways. This intersection of technology and art is transforming how we experience and engage with visual content.
